Koln fire Kwasniok, name Wagner interim coach for rest of season

COLOGNE, Germany (AP) — Koln fired Lukas Kwasniok as coach on Sunday as the team’s seven-game winless run left it just outside the relegation zone in the Bundesliga.

Koln made it clear in a statement that Saturday’s 3-3 draw with Borussia Mönchengladbach in the Rhine derby was the final straw for Kwasniok and his assistant Frank Kaspari. The club announced that former assistant coach René Wagner was taking over as interim coach for the remaining seven games of the season.

“We simply haven’t picked up enough points – that’s the reality. Against this background, after intensive analysis, we decided to release Lukas,” managing director Thomas Kessler said.

Kwasniok joined promoted Koln from Paderborn last summer and had a contract until 2028. His team was knocked out of the German Cup by Bayern Munich and has earned 26 points in 27 games in the Bundesliga, where the derby draw left it two points above St. Pauli in the relegation playoff place.

“I will do everything in my power to ensure we remain in the Bundesliga,” Wagner said.
